Agencies obsess over the pitch. Clients obsess over whether you actually understand the business.

In this episode, Jason Harris sits down with Robin and Stephen Boehler, founders of Mercer Island Group and authors of It’s Not About You: Winning New Business in a Crowded Agency World, to unpack why most agencies lose new business before they even walk into the room—and what the winners do differently.

Key Takeaways:✅ Most clients can’t name agencies—your agency brand has to earn recognition✅ Strategy (not creative alone) is the biggest predictor of winning the business✅ “Prospect-friendly” means leading with the client’s business, not your credentials✅ Great Q&A is preparation (and skipping the gimmicks)

Memorable Moments:💡 “Clients can’t name any agencies 95% of the time.”💡 “Your agency acting like a brand is critically important.”💡 “Creative without strategy turns everything into subjective opinions.”💡 “Chemistry can disqualify you if it’s bad.”💡 “It’s not ‘which one’—it’s the why.”
